As I spent time understanding Apro AT, I realized the project is focused on something many people overlook in crypto: data accuracy. Blockchains canât function properly if the information they receive from outside sources is wrong. Whether itâs pricing, analytics, or real-world inputs, bad data can break smart contracts. Apro AT is trying to improve this process by using smarter validation and AI-driven checks before data is used on-chain.
From my point of view, this is not the kind of project that creates instant hype. Itâs more like background infrastructure. You donât notice it much, but everything depends on it working properly. Over time, Iâve noticed that projects like this often survive longer than trend-based tokens, even if they grow quietly.
What I personally appreciate is the multi-chain mindset. Crypto is no longer about one blockchain dominating everything. Different networks exist for different reasons, and they all need reliable data. Apro AT seems built with this reality in mind, which gives it a more future-ready feel.
That being said, Iâm not blindly optimistic. The oracle space already has strong players, and gaining trust in this area is not easy. Developers wonât switch systems unless thereâs clear value and proven reliability. Apro AT still has work to do in showing long-term consistency and real adoption.
